THE ULTIMATE GUIDE TO NASHVILLE TN

The Ultimate Guide To Nashville TN

Commercial landscape facilities in Nashville, TN, cater to various businesses, including corporate offices, retail centers, hotels, and industrial facilities. These services ensure that flyer properties preserve a polished and well-kept ventilate throughout the year.Types of trailer Landscaping ServicesProfessional classified ad landscapers find th

read more